Also, How fast can the iPhone 12 charge?
Using USB-C, you can charge the iPhone 12 Pro to 50% in about 30 minutes. The highest wattage the iPhone 12 Pro will use is around 22 watts, so a 20 watt or 30 watt charger will result in the about same charging speed. But basically any USB-C charger will be significantly faster than the old USB-A chargers.

Furthermore Does the iPhone 12 come with a charger?
Apple no longer includes the standard USB charging brick with the iPhone 12, iPhone 12 Pro or iPhone 12 mini. There is only one cable included in the box — a USB-C to Lightning cable. … The iPhone 12 series of iPhones instead comes with a USB-C to Lightning cable.

How do I know if my iPhone 12 is fast charging?
There isn’t a notification or alert to indicate your iPhone is using fast charge. When you use fast charge with supported iPhone models, you can recharge your iPhone up to 50 percent battery in around 30 minutes. The time that it takes to recharge can help determine if your iPhone is fast charging.

Why is my iPhone battery draining so fast all of a sudden?
If you see your iPhone battery draining too fast suddenly, one of the major reasons may be poor cellular service. When you are in a place of low signal, your iPhone will increase the power to the antenna in order to stay connected enough to receive calls and maintain a data connection.

Is it bad to charge iPhone 12 overnight?
Your iPhone 12 can lose battery life if you charge overnight. Like other smartphones, the iPhone 12 Pro has an average of about 500 to 1,000 charge cycles per battery. One charge cycle is the equivalent of going from 100% to 0% battery. However, any combination of drainage over multiple days can equal a charge.

How many watts is iPhone fast charger?
Apple 20W USB-C power adapter
Note: For fast charging, iPhone 12 and later models require a power adapter with a minimum power output of 20 watts, such as the Apple 20W USB power adapter. If you use a third-party power adapter, it should meet these recommended specifications: Frequency: 50 to 60 Hz, single phase.

How long do iPhone batteries last?
Q: How long do iPhone batteries typically last? It depends on how you use your iPhone, but typically an iPhone battery will be “like new” for about 2 years. They can go about 4 years before you really need to have them replaced.
